In this video, you will recognize that volume is additive, by finding the volume of a 3D
figure composed of two rectangular prisms.
![Page 2: In this video, you will recognize that volume is additive, by finding the volume of a 3D figure composed of two rectangular prisms.](https://reader035.fdocuments.us/reader035/viewer/2022072016/56649eec5503460f94bfdead/html5/thumbnails/2.jpg)
volume – the number of cubic units needed to fill the space inside a three-dimensional figure
![Page 3: In this video, you will recognize that volume is additive, by finding the volume of a 3D figure composed of two rectangular prisms.](https://reader035.fdocuments.us/reader035/viewer/2022072016/56649eec5503460f94bfdead/html5/thumbnails/3.jpg)
volume of a rectangular prism = length x width x height
